Embrace the Chaos

Not conscious of infinities blast Big Bang into reality our matter hurled 
The Moira in our ancient past held us captive in this world

The blessings are the curses in every man’s situation
A profound secret and mystery to one another—the human condition
The secret suffering souls demand such solemn serious speculation
Yet the absurdity of LIFE in all its levity and evanescence calls for circumspection…

We create the stories and gods in hopes 
And we assign such meaning to everything: stars, numbers, tea-leaves, and dates…
We create stories and gods to fill the voids find star- crossed loves and faith in the fates 
In all the randomness—the beautiful randomness 
We live, we love, we kiss, and we miss the beauty of chance

Kierkegaard a product of his time
his philosophical bent in line 
had yet to be—to see—the reality—
       of Camu or Sartre in thoughts evolution
one solution to counter mother Nature’s hostility or indifference, 
We wield power over her mock her, scorn her, show her! 
I am not the powerless weak little creature born to die at your whim—
No sin to go—my existence I control. 

But halt! Oh! our Jungian collective-consciousness in the present soon awakens swooned by modern bards, agnostics and atheists even religious faith shaken
A light! A light! A revelation!

Because that which is unseen we know to exist
The unknown exists and because we don’t know it's purpose.. perhaps there is perhaps there is not one, 
The horizon we see with our eyes does not exist in reality Physics concrete Science save us…
Our eyes set to betray us… 
All this unknown doesn't mean we can't embrace the chaos 

And we assign such meaning to everything: stars, numbers, tea-leaves, and dates…
Yet it all does exist with a beauty more lovely than any of Shakespeare's fates...
